Find out about life and property in the relaxed suburb of Eldoraigne, in Centurion West.

The relaxed suburb of Eldoraigne, south-west of Pretoria city centre, with its spacious properties, caring residents and entertaining sports facilities offers an eventful sanctuary for young professionals, families and retirees to call home. The suburb lies between Lorentz Road and Jan Road in the north, Clanwilliam Street to the south, Willem Botha Street, Boekenhout Road and Piet Hugo Street to the west, with Old Johannesburg Road to the east.

The Wierdabrug Community Policing Forum assists with crime prevention in the area and liaises closely with local police, creating close communication among neighbours and arranging patrols to ensure improved safety of the neighbourhood.

When it comes to sports in Eldoraigne, choose to play a game of tennis at Eldoraigne Tennis Club or golf at Zwartkop Country Club. The Matsport Centre, which is home to the South African Gymnastics Federation, provides trampoline, acrobatics, rope skipping and rhythmic gymnastics, while Zwartop Raceway provides local and international motorsport, karting, 4x4 motoring, and driving instruction.

Premiere shopping facilities available in the area and include Eldoraigne Village Shopping Centre, Eldo Square, Mall at Reds, Lyttelton Shopping Centre and Centurion Mall.

A number of restaurants with interesting cuisine can be found in Eldoraigne such as Pizzeria Enzo, Zagora Grill Room Restaurant and Ocean Basket. Top schools in and around the suburb are Hoërskool Eldoraigne, Sutherland High School, Hoërskool Zwartkop, Empro Academy and Laerskool Wierdapark providing learners with academics, sports and culture activities.

Medical professionals will keep you in good health at Netcare Medicross Saxby, Eldoraigne Village Pharmacy and R101 Medical Centre and Pharmacy. With friendly residents and great leisure and sporting facilities for all ages, Eldoraigne provides a harmonious setting where you will enjoy an entertaining lifestyle.

“My heart is in Eldoraigne as my family set down roots in the area. Familiar surroundings bring back fond memories of teenage years spent driving a motorcycle to the weekend movie at Eldoraigne High School, Zwartkop Drive-in or at Zwartkop Race Track” - Paul Gerber, resident of Eldoraigne.
